Warm-Season Lawns

This spring has been odd indeed, as we are experiencing a record drought that began in September 2025. That has continued into spring, and even though we have had some warm temperatures, many turfgrasses are still struggling due to a lack of moisture and heat. When this is posted, I am sure some will say, "But it is 96°F today,” but those temperatures have been far from consistent. After reviewing almost three months of soil temperature data, it is clear that we are nowhere near optimal temperatures for the growth of warm-season grasses. Most warm-season grasses grow optimally when soil temperatures are between 75 and 85°F, and we have just recently eclipsed 75°F. Couple the lack of heat with limited soil moisture, and you get slow greenup of warm-season grasses. Yet my local golf course looks green. That is likely true, but their irrigation system is designed to be effective and efficient, resulting in improved greenup for them. The good news about the current environmental conditions is that turf pathogens are not happy either. Not many living things thrive under dramatic temperature swings and low moisture. For warm-season grasses, be patient as soil temperatures continue to rise and, hopefully, rainfall develops; these lawns will look great in no time.

Cool-Season Lawns

Tall fescue is also struggling due to a lack of moisture. If one has an irrigation system, the lawn is probably doing quite well. If not, there are likely dry spots and growth limitations due to insufficient rainfall. If one observes leaf spots or lesions, there is almost no chance of disease developing under the current moisture conditions. Remember, fungi need at least 8 hours of leaf wetness to initiate an infection, and even with irrigation, that is highly unlikely under our current conditions. With the lack of rainfall, we have also had very low relative humidity, which works against disease development in plants. Even with the recent uptick in temperatures, there is still plenty of time to start preventive fungicide applications in tall fescue lawns. Pathogens require time to grow, infect, colonize, and damage plants. Optimal conditions for brown patch and gray leaf spot are elevated temperatures and leaf wetness, and the latter has essentially been nonexistent. Be patient; if we start to get rain and humidity, those diseases will show up.

Golf Course Issues

We are still in the window for preventive fairy ring applications for both warm- and cool-season grass putting greens. We are also still within the window for preventive nematode suppression on both putting green grasses. We are almost outside the window for preventive Pythium root dysfunction (PRD) applications for creeping bentgrass in the Piedmont and the East. That window is probably in prime time for those in the mountains. Other than some PRD, we aren’t seeing much on creeping bentgrass putting greens. For bermudagrass putting greens, we have seen root-knot nematode and take-all root rot (TARR) symptoms. Root-knot nematodes are likely active now, and our research indicates a nematicide would be effective. For TARR, those pathogens are not active now; the damage that occurred in the fall is only now developing due to the lack of moisture and optimal temperatures for bermudagrass. If TARR pathogens were active, any fungicide applied for preventative fairy ring control should, of course, stop their activity, depending on the fungicide selected.
